Transaction 661bf6bf7af85e6e54c3d11cc08b96bf3746b456efb9e8d0448e762e124fcab5

1 Input
2 Outputs
  • 661bf6bf7af85e6e54c3d11cc08b96bf3746b456efb9e8d0448e762e124fcab5:0
  • value  360021587
    address  3Dgdo7v4DjTLVs5SpnUMiktTCBLYYPbWWX
  • 661bf6bf7af85e6e54c3d11cc08b96bf3746b456efb9e8d0448e762e124fcab5:1
  • value  708200
    address  3AnNgzXPAPVWj3g4gNGp89SNAy7HRjtUzk